Hi there, It's very unusual to have PV without JAK2 mutation, but still possible as far as I know. The next step is to perform BMB to check what's going on with bone marrow.

What are your blood counts when they are not normal and what type of neuropathy you have?

Mazcd profile image
MazcdPartnerMPNVoice in reply to Alexbits

about 97% of people who have PV have the JAK2 mutation.
